Health Secretary voices concerns over puberty blocker trial


The Health Secretary has said he’s “not comfortable” with the upcoming puberty blockers trial. King’s College London has been given funding of £10.7 million for the Pathways project, which includes the controversial trial. Health Secretary Wes Streeting announced an indefinite ban on the drugs last year due to evidence that ‘the current prescribing pathway’ posed an “unacceptable safety risk” to children and young people. The pathways study involves a whole range of treatments and care, including therapeutic mental health support, but it also included a trial on this puberty blockers thing. The Health Secretary added: “It’s gone through rounds and rounds of ethical approvals to approve this kind of study.
